Background:
IGF1R (Insulin Like Growth Factor 1 Receptor) is a Protein Coding gene. Diseases associated with IGF1R include Insulin-Like Growth Factor I and Leprechaunism. Among its related pathways are Transcription Androgen Receptor nuclear signaling and p70S6K Signaling. This receptor binds insulin-like growth factor with a high affinity. It has tyrosine kinase activity. The insulin-like growth factor I receptor plays a critical role in transformation events. Cleavage of the precursor generates alpha and beta subunits. It is highly overexpressed in most malignant tissues where it functions as an anti-apoptotic agent by enhancing cell survival. Al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ding distinct isoforms have been found for IGF1Re.
